On Saint Patrick’s Day Saint Nicholas, aka Santa Claus, & Mrs. Holly Claus along with their children, Nick, and Mary, traveled to the heart of Ireland. There were also three Elves who came along for the flying sleigh ride. Several other Elves and other North Pole Citizens arrived by other means. There they visited the secret stronghold of the Leprechauns. Santa’s normally bright red sleigh was magically tinted glimmering green with glittering gold runners in honor of the luckiest Lilliputians on Earth! The sleigh mystically pulled by nine levitating reindeer flew across sunny Irish skies and followed a mystical Rainbow to its supernatural end. There Santa gracefully landed in a field of shimmering shamrocks near the magically cloaked Leprechaun Village in the early afternoon. He met with the Leader Of The Leprechauns, King Lochlann, who gave the Claus Family the grand tour of their enchanted enclave including the crystal clear Lucky Lake at the center.

The Majestic Shores Of Lucky Lake

Lucky Lake is the largest natural magical wishing well on the planet.  The entire lake bed shimmers brightly from all the gold coins lining the bottom. Santa threw in his annual ceremonial gold North Pole coin and made an undisclosed wish. Lochlann then blessed Santa & his holy family with fantastic fortune in an ancient traditional Leprechaun luck ceremony. Santa was presented with a bag of Supernatural Shamrock’s, and Lucky Charms. No, we’re not talking about the cereal here folks! A flock of Leprechauns was milling about as they conversed with Santa’s enchanted Elves. Leprechauns share a kinship with Elves as they evolved from the same supernatural species.

As evening approached Santa Claus changed into traditional Leprechaun garb provided as a gift in an XXXX-Large size.  However, The Great Claus still left his trademark red stocking cap on.  At sunset, an exalted ceremony of enchantment was conducted to summon the Angel Saint Patrick who is the Patron Saint of the Leprechauns, and all the Irish people. He is the ultimate leader of St. Patrick’s Day who professionally organized the Leprechauns sometime in the 5th century in their mission of spreading global good luck. Before that Leprechauns had mainly stayed in Ireland and were more concerned with collecting gold which does have a natural attraction of metaphysical luck.  They were originally created by the Irish nature Gods to be miners and managers of Gold.

From the Heavens in a green sparkling aura of fantastical light, the Angel Patrick descended down past the iridescent sunset as everyone was struck silent in awe of the awesome sight. Saint Patrick materialized wearing a dark emerald silk robe sparking with Shamrocks as a glittering gold halo was just barely visible above his head. King Lochlann and the other Lilliputians bowed before their patron Saint. Santa, being a half-Archangel, and a Saint himself, walked over to him.  He shook his hand heartily while loudly saying, “Ho ho ho Merry Saint Patrick’s Day our most honored Irish Angel Patrick!” Patrick then replied, “God bless you my saintly brother Nicholas! Everyone in Heaven appreciates all you do to aid the cause of goodness on our fine Lords Earth!”

As night fell torches of holy emerald-tinted flames were lit. Everyone took a seat at a long glimmering green table with specks of glittering gold in it.  It was supposedly made of “infinite” shamrocks paranormally pressed together amid the luck of saintly shredded gold by Leprechaun, and Elf artisans many centuries ago!  The titanic table was set with pure solid gold dishware in front of a large outdoor amphitheater. The honored guests were served a sumptuous seven-course supper. Then some of the Leprechauns put on a stupendous show which included singing, dancing, and magnificent magic.  There was even a special guest starring appearance from a usually shy Unicorn who was quite jubilant! Not to mention that Pegasus who randomly flew from the Heavens with glorious glee!

Saint Patrick Bids His Fellow Saint Farewell

When the show ended toward the Midnight Witching Hour the Saints Patrick, and Nicholas rose along with everyone else sitting at the table to applaud, and cheer with glee. Saint Patrick then led the entire crowd to Lucky Lake where he blessed the waters holy and baptized seven lucky Leprechauns. Saint Nicholas did the same with 12 other Leprechauns. The baptizing process was a way to appease the Archangel hierarchy when Patrick first proposed embracing the Pagan Leprechauns who were the direct product of the Earthly Gods, and Goddesses.  So Leprechauns are not only lucky but holy as well!

Saint Patrick bid everyone a warm farewell, and wade into the blessed holy waters causing it to glow brightly in a neon spring green hue. Once at the center of the lake, he waved majestically while floating upward.  Patrick ascended into the dark starry skies glittering blindly with green, and gold as he phased away ascending back to the Heavenly dimensions above. This caused a serene shower of glittering energy flakes to fall forth upon everyone like magical snow. Several Leprechauns began scurrying about collecting the substance in glass jars as it was the pure essence of holy luck.  Saint Nicholas then took a loving leave of his little friends.  The Claus Family’s sleigh shot off into the sky in a flurry of sparkling red, green, and white light. They arrived back at North Pole City at 2:00 AM Greenwich Mean Time. Most of the other North Pole residents left as well except for a small security contingent of Elves. They work for the North Pole City Treasury and were there for a currency exchange. They turned in their old circulated gold coins for new ones freshly imbued with luck. Upon returning they would stamp the glittering gold coins with the official NPC emblems.
